Abstract
Reported here is the synthesis of a new macrocycle bearing anionic carboxylate groups with water-soluble aggregation-induced emission(AIE).The water-soluble macrocycle without typical AIE luminogens is con-structed based on the building block of benzothiadiazole.It exhibits a remarkable AIE effect.This water-soluble macrocycle can selectively bind different types of biogenic amines in aqueous media with the tightest binding towards spermine.The fluorescence enhancement induced by supramolecular encapsu-lation is used to detect spermine.
